测试全流程
This commit is contained in:
parent
28dc4ec60d
commit
480e5016e3
@ -1,4 +1,4 @@
|
|||||||
VITE_MODE = production
|
VITE_MODE = prd
|
||||||
VITE_HOST = https://hd.xglpa.com
|
VITE_HOST = https://hd.xglpa.com
|
||||||
VITE_CDN = https://cdn.xglpa.com
|
VITE_CDN = https://cdn.xglpa.com
|
||||||
VITE_FOLDER = /vite-4
|
VITE_FOLDER = /vite-4
|
||||||
@ -6,8 +6,8 @@
|
|||||||
"scripts": {
|
"scripts": {
|
||||||
"dev": "vite",
|
"dev": "vite",
|
||||||
"fat": "vite --mode fat",
|
"fat": "vite --mode fat",
|
||||||
"build:fat": "vite build --mode fat",
|
"build-fat": "vite build --mode fat",
|
||||||
"build:prod": "vite build --mode production",
|
"build-prd": "vite build --mode prd",
|
||||||
"preview": "vite preview"
|
"preview": "vite preview"
|
||||||
},
|
},
|
||||||
"dependencies": {
|
"dependencies": {
|
||||||
|
|||||||
@ -50,6 +50,9 @@ onMounted(() => {
|
|||||||
res => {
|
res => {
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
console.log('我的奖品', res);
|
console.log('我的奖品', res);
|
||||||
|
if(res.data){
|
||||||
|
// userStore.updatePrize(code,money)
|
||||||
|
}
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
)
|
)
|
||||||
|
|||||||
@ -104,6 +104,8 @@ const showResult = (event) => {
|
|||||||
subAnswer({}, userStore.token).then((res) => {
|
subAnswer({}, userStore.token).then((res) => {
|
||||||
console.log("key:", res);
|
console.log("key:", res);
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
|
userStore.updateDrawKey(res.data)
|
||||||
|
|
||||||
}
|
}
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|||||||
@ -22,6 +22,10 @@ const page = [
|
|||||||
'qa/prev-btn.png',
|
'qa/prev-btn.png',
|
||||||
'qa/answer-box-2.png',
|
'qa/answer-box-2.png',
|
||||||
'qa/answer-box-1.png',
|
'qa/answer-box-1.png',
|
||||||
|
'music-off.png',
|
||||||
|
'music-on.png',
|
||||||
|
|
||||||
|
|
||||||
]
|
]
|
||||||
|
|
||||||
// 处理为vite引入图片格式
|
// 处理为vite引入图片格式
|
||||||
|
|||||||
@ -77,7 +77,7 @@ const drawFn = (item) => {
|
|||||||
}
|
}
|
||||||
};
|
};
|
||||||
|
|
||||||
const showResult = ref(true);
|
const showResult = ref(false);
|
||||||
const resultFn = (item) => {
|
const resultFn = (item) => {
|
||||||
if (item.action == "hide") {
|
if (item.action == "hide") {
|
||||||
showResult.value = false;
|
showResult.value = false;
|
||||||
@ -96,7 +96,9 @@ const ruleFn = (item) => {
|
|||||||
|
|
||||||
onMounted(() => {
|
onMounted(() => {
|
||||||
let code = getQueryString("code");
|
let code = getQueryString("code");
|
||||||
|
let url = import.meta.env.VITE_URL;
|
||||||
console.log("code:", code);
|
console.log("code:", code);
|
||||||
|
console.log("url:", url);
|
||||||
|
|
||||||
let dev = import.meta.env.VITE_MODE;
|
let dev = import.meta.env.VITE_MODE;
|
||||||
if (dev != "dev") {
|
if (dev != "dev") {
|
||||||
@ -110,7 +112,7 @@ onMounted(() => {
|
|||||||
showLoad.value = true;
|
showLoad.value = true;
|
||||||
return;
|
return;
|
||||||
} else {
|
} else {
|
||||||
authorize({ scopeType: 1 }).then((res) => {
|
authorize({ scopeType: 1,redirectUri:url }).then((res) => {
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
console.log("重定向地址:", res.data);
|
console.log("重定向地址:", res.data);
|
||||||
location.replace(res.data);
|
location.replace(res.data);
|
||||||
@ -147,7 +149,7 @@ onMounted(() => {
|
|||||||
}
|
}
|
||||||
});
|
});
|
||||||
} else {
|
} else {
|
||||||
authorize({ scopeType: 1 }).then((res) => {
|
authorize({ scopeType: 1,redirectUri:url }).then((res) => {
|
||||||
if (res.code == 0) {
|
if (res.code == 0) {
|
||||||
console.log("重定向地址:", res.data);
|
console.log("重定向地址:", res.data);
|
||||||
location.replace(res.data);
|
location.replace(res.data);
|
||||||
|
|||||||
@ -7,8 +7,6 @@ const linkUrl = import.meta.env.VITE_HOST + import.meta.env.VITE_FOLDER
|
|||||||
|
|
||||||
export function wxShare(option) {
|
export function wxShare(option) {
|
||||||
let url = location.href.split('#')[0];
|
let url = location.href.split('#')[0];
|
||||||
// qiween: https://www.qiween.com/wxapi/api/jsconfig
|
|
||||||
// 信蜂: https://wx.xfhd.net/wxapi/api/jsconfig?appid=wx41d80a1bb01f658d
|
|
||||||
axios.get('https://wx.xfhd.net/wxapi/api/jsconfig?appid=wx41d80a1bb01f658d', {
|
axios.get('https://wx.xfhd.net/wxapi/api/jsconfig?appid=wx41d80a1bb01f658d', {
|
||||||
params: { url }
|
params: { url }
|
||||||
})
|
})
|
||||||
|
|||||||
@ -18,7 +18,7 @@ export default defineConfig(({ command, mode }) => {
|
|||||||
return {
|
return {
|
||||||
define: {
|
define: {
|
||||||
// enable hydration mismatch details in production build
|
// enable hydration mismatch details in production build
|
||||||
__VUE_PROD_HYDRATION_MISMATCH_DETAILS__: mode == 'production' ? 'false' : 'true',
|
__VUE_PROD_HYDRATION_MISMATCH_DETAILS__: mode == 'prd' ? 'false' : 'true',
|
||||||
},
|
},
|
||||||
|
|
||||||
plugins: [
|
plugins: [
|
||||||
@ -125,8 +125,8 @@ export default defineConfig(({ command, mode }) => {
|
|||||||
terserOptions: {
|
terserOptions: {
|
||||||
compress: {
|
compress: {
|
||||||
//生产环境时移除打印日志
|
//生产环境时移除打印日志
|
||||||
// drop_console: mode == 'production' ? true : false,
|
// drop_console: mode == 'prd' ? true : false,
|
||||||
// drop_debugger: mode == 'production' ? true : false,
|
// drop_debugger: mode == 'prd' ? true : false,
|
||||||
},
|
},
|
||||||
},
|
},
|
||||||
|
|
||||||
|
|||||||
Loading…
Reference in New Issue
Block a user